Description
Technical Field
The utility model relates to the technical field of tobacco equipment, in particular to a tensioning device for a belt conveyor synchronous belt.
Background
At present, the transmission synchronous belt tensioning device of the tobacco processing belt conveyor is unreasonable in design and has the following defects during use: 1) the original tensioning device is complex in design, is difficult to disassemble and assemble during maintenance, increases the maintenance workload, is easy to loosen, and influences the working effect of the device; 2) the original tensioning device is made of unreasonable metal materials without reinforcing ribs, and has the defects of vibration, high noise, easy abrasion and fracture during working and production interruption; 3) when the existing device is used, the part contacted with the conveying part is worn and broken, and the equipment is required to be completely removed for replacement or maintenance.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
As shown in fig. 1, the tensioning device for belt conveyor synchronous belt comprises a first connecting piece 1, a second connecting piece 2, a tensioning wheel 3 and a synchronous belt 4, wherein the first connecting piece 1 is an L-shaped bent plate-shaped structure composed of a transverse surface 11 and a vertical surface 12, the vertical surface 12 is provided with a plurality of mounting holes 5, the first connecting piece 1 is detachably mounted on a frame wall plate 6 through the mounting holes 5 on the vertical surface 12, the tensioning wheel 3 is fixedly mounted at the upper end of the transverse surface 11 of the first connecting piece 1, when the first connecting piece 1 is fixedly mounted on the frame wall plate 6, the tensioning wheel 3 on the transverse surface 11 is just positioned right below the synchronous belt 4, the second connecting piece 2 is fixedly mounted right below the transverse surface 11 of the first connecting piece 1, the middle part of the second connecting piece 2 is provided with an adjusting bolt 7, the other end of the adjusting bolt 7 passes through the second connecting piece 2 and is tightly attached to the bottom of the transverse surface 11 of the first connecting piece 1; the mounting hole 5 in the vertical surface 12 is a long round hole, and the mounting hole 5 is arranged in the vertical direction; a plurality of reinforcing plates 8 are uniformly arranged between the vertical surface 12 and the transverse surface 11 of the first connecting piece 1; the reinforcing plate 8 is of a triangular structure, and the tensioning wheel 3 is made of rubber.
The utility model has reasonable structural design, can quickly complete the position adjustment of the tension pulley 3, thereby ensuring that the synchronous belt 4 is in a proper tension degree, and the tension pulley 3 is made of rubber materials in the utility model, thereby reducing the noise generated when the synchronous belt 4 is contacted with the tension pulley 3 and improving the working environment on site. When the position of the tensioning wheel 3 needs to be adjusted, the fastening bolt between the vertical surface 12 of the first connecting piece 1 and the rack wall plate 6 can be loosened firstly, then the adjusting bolt 7 is rotated, the height of the transverse surface 11 of the first connecting piece 1 is adjusted through the adjusting bolt 7, and therefore the position of the tensioning wheel 3 is adjusted, and the tensioning degree of the synchronous belt 4 is adjusted. The utility model can be adjusted in the running process of the synchronous belt 4 without stopping, and the adjusting bolt 7 is adopted for adjustment to ensure the adjusting precision of the tension wheel 3, so that the synchronous belt 4 is in a proper tension degree.
